Kathryn Hahn has joined the cast of Tomorrowland, Disney’s Brad Bird-directed sci-fi adventure movie.
George Clooney, Hugh Laurie and Britt Robertson are starring in the picture, which is currently shooting in Vancouver.
The story, as described by Disney, centers on a “bright, optimistic teen bursting with scientific curiosity and a former boy-genius inventor jaded by disillusionment who embark on a danger-filled mission to unearth the secrets of an enigmatic place somewhere in time and space that exists in their collective memory as Tomorrowland.”
Character descriptions are being kept secret, but it can be revealed that Hahn is playing a character named Ursula in what is described as a funny, scene-stealing role.
Hahn is an expert at the latter, with her talents on view in the recent New Line comedy We’re the Millers. She’ll next be seen in The Secret Life of Walter Mitty and recently wrapped Shawn Levy’s This Is Where I Leave You.
Hahn is repped by Gersh, Brillstein Entertainment Partners and Schreck Rose.
